Mei Yamazaki (山﨑愛生), born on June 28, 2005, in Sapporo, Hokkaido, is a talented Japanese pop singer and dancer, recognized as a 15th generation member of the iconic idol group Morning Musume under Hello! Project. Known affectionately as "Mei-chan," she has quickly made a name for herself in the vibrant world of J-pop.

Early Career

Mei's journey began in 2014 when she auditioned to model for Ciao Girl magazine. Her passion for performance led her to successfully audition for Hello! Project's "Hokkaido Gentei" in 2015. By July 2016, she was officially introduced as one of the first members of Hello Pro Kenshuusei Hokkaido during a concert in Sapporo, marking the start of her professional career.

Rising Through the Ranks

Yamazaki's talent and dedication quickly became evident during her time with Hello Pro Kenshuusei Hokkaido. On May 6, 2018, she won the judge's singing award at the Hello! Project Kenshuusei Happyoukai 2018 ~Haru no Koukai Jitsuryoku Shindan Test~ event for her performance of "Wonderful World (English Ver.)". This achievement highlighted her vocal abilities and set her apart from her peers.

Joining Morning Musume

YThe most significant milestone in Yamazaki's career came in 2019 when she was selected to join Morning Musume as part of its 15th generation. This opportunity catapulted her into the spotlight and introduced her to a wider audience. Yamazaki and her fellow 15th generation members were introduced on stage during the Hello! Project 2019 SUMMER concert tour, marking the beginning of their journey with one of Japan's most beloved girl groups.

Debut and Early Activities

Yamazaki's debut with Morning Musume was met with excitement from fans. On August 28, 2019, she participated in her first fanclub event, Morning Musume '19 15ki Member FC Event, at Yamano Hall alongside her fellow 15th generation members, Rio Kitagawa and Homare Okamura.

To further connect with fans, Yamazaki and her generation mates began a fanclub-exclusive web talk show titled "Three stations" on September 5, 2019. This initiative allowed fans to get to know the new members better and showcased Yamazaki's personality outside of her performances.

Expanding Her Horizons

In addition to her music career, Yamazaki has also ventured into other areas of entertainment. She made her acting debut in the Japanese drama "Mayonaka ni Hello!" in 2022, appearing as a guest in episodes 3 and 10[4].
